Axpona-Logo-RedGreyGIK Acoustics exhibited at AXPONA – Audio Expo North America – at the Westin O’Hare in Chicago from April 15-17.

Display Booth in the Volti Lounge

We proudly debuted the new Black and White plate options on the Alpha Series. We showcased a variety of color and size options as well as displayed some of our most popular products.

We provided Tri-Trap Corner Bass Traps and FreeStand Acoustic Panels for Ryan Speakers which was awarded an Audio Oasis by Positive Feedback.

GIK Acoustics collaborates with Grammy-winning mastering engineer Adam Ayan on world-class new studio

GIK Acoustics has collaborated with Grammy, multi-Latin Grammy and TEC Award-winning mastering engineer Adam Ayan to design and build his new mastering studio, Ayan Mastering, in Portland, Maine. The project marks Ayan’s first independent facility following the closure of the legendary Gateway Mastering, where he spent over 25 years shaping some of the world’s most iconic records.
